Shirley MacLaine stars in "Coco Chanel," which airs this Saturday on Lifetime.

On what interested her about Coco Chanel:

Her contradictions. Her conflict between love and ambition. She never married. She was rude, hurtful. Many men were in love with her -- though I don't know why, because she was impossible. She was 73 when she got so popular, and she was always reinventing herself. I like that.

On her own sense of style:

I like senior-forgiving sloppy pants. I still wear sweat suits. I look like a real bag lady when I go to Starbucks with my dog and get my chai. I am so grateful that I now have a small hunk of Chanel wardrobe from the film that will go anywhere.

On Karl Lagerfeld:

He wanted me to come to Paris for a fitting, but I am sorry. No. If he takes off his sunglasses and the gloves, maybe I'll go to Paris.
